Let’s break it down: "For I am not ashamed of the gospel, because it is the power of God that brings salvation to everyone who believes: first to the Jew, then to the Gentile. For in the gospel the righteousness of God is revealed—a righteousness that is by faith from first to last, just as it is written: 'The righteous will live by faith.'" The phrase "I am not ashamed of the gospel" was a huge turning point for me. I used to worry about what people would think if I openly talked about God or my faith journey. There's a subtle pressure, sometimes, to keep spiritual things private. But this verse, for me, clarified that the gospel isn’t something to hide or feel embarrassed about; it’s the very "power of God that brings salvation." It makes you realize that what we have in Christ is the most incredible, life-changing truth, not a secret to guard. It shifts your perspective from fearing judgment to understanding the immense value and hope found in God's salvation plan. Overcoming embarrassment about faith isn't an overnight process. It's a gradual journey of confidence building, rooted in understanding what you believe and why. For me, it involved a lot of personal reflection, reading, and honestly, a lot of prayer for boldness. I remember one of my notebook pages highlighted a specific prayer asking for courage to speak up, even when my heart was racing. It’s about recognizing that the message isn't about *me*, but about the transformative power of God's love. Applying faith to spread the gospel doesn't always mean standing on a street corner preaching. Sometimes, it's simply living out your faith authentically. It’s about showing kindness, offering a listening ear, or sharing a personal testimony when the opportunity arises. It's about being a light in your everyday interactions, letting your actions speak volumes, and then being prepared to explain the hope you have within you. I’ve found that often, people are more open to hearing about faith when they see it genuinely lived out in someone else’s life.
